18、HTML

HTML

超文本标记语言(Hyper Text Markup Language)。

用来描述网页的一种语言。

HTML标签

由尖括号包围的关键词。 如:<html>

通常是成对出现的,开始标签和结束标签。 如:<html>和</html>

HTML文档

用来描述网页。

包含HTML标签和文本。

文档的结构

<!DOCTYPE html>
<html lang="zh-CN">
    <head>
        <title>网页标题</title>
        <meta charset="gb2312">
        <meta name="keywords" content="关键字">
        <meta name="description" content="详细描述">
    </head>
<body>
    网页内容
</body>
</html>

常用特殊字符

显示    代码
<      &lt;
>      &gt;
&      &amp;
"      &quot;
©      &copy;
®      &reg;
×      &times;
÷      &divide;
¥     &yen;
§      &sect;
£     &pound;
¢     &cent;
       &nbsp;

常用HTML标签

注释 <!-- --> <!--这是一段注释。注释不会在浏览器中显示。-->
定义规范 <!DOCTYPE> 三种文档类型:Strict、Transitional 以及 Frameset。
超链接 <a> 外链:<a href="http://www.baidu.com/ " target="_blank" title="点击跳转百度">百度</a>
页内:<a name="a">啊</a> <a href="#a">跳转到啊</a>
邮箱: <a href="mailto:[email protected]">点击发邮件</a>
署名 <address>
用来定义署名地址。
标题 <hn> <h1> 定义最大的标题。<h6> 定义最小的标题。
换行 <br> 不产生一个新段落的情况下进行换行,接着上一行换行。
段落 <p> 产生一个新段落,换行空一行。<p align="left center right">左中右对齐</p>
预格式文本 <pre> 用于显示预先在源代码中定义好的格式。
居中对齐 <center> 使内容居中对齐。
水平线 <hr> 在 HTML 页面中创建一条水平线。<hr size="5" color="red" width="300" /> size高度 color 颜色 width长度
文字 <font> 用来定义文字字体 样式 大小颜色等。<font size="字号" color="颜色" face="字体"></font>
滚动标签 <marquee> direction方向 bihavior方式=scroll(一直滚)slide(一次)alternate(交替式)loop次数 scrollamount速度
图片 <img> 在网页中显示图片。<img src="路径" width="宽度" height高度 alt="提示" align="top bottom left right" vspace="10" hspace="10" />   vspace hspace文字间距 align 与文本对齐方式
有序列表 <ol> 数字/编号 自动排序 type="1 a A i I " <ol><li>
无序列表 <ul> 可实心 空心 方形 <ul><li>
文字样式 b粗体 i斜体 u下划线 del删除线 span em strong cite code kbdsamp sub sup var acronym abbr dfn bdo
表格 <table> 定义一个表格 border cellspacing设置内框宽度 cellpadding 文字与边框的距离。
<tr> 表格中的行 还可以设置tfoot th tbody thead来分组。
单元格 <td> 表格中的单元格 rowspan合并行 colspan合并列。
表单 <form> method="post get" action="http://www.baidu.com/login.aspx" method提交方式 action提交地址
文本框 <input> type="text" name="name" value="value" size="20" maxlength="20" size长度 maxlength最大长度
隐藏域 <input> type="hidden" name="hidden" value=""
密码框 <input> type="password" name="name" value="value" size="20" maxlength="20"
单选按钮 <input> type="radio" name="name" value="value" checked="checked" name相同为一组 value区分值 单选
复选按钮 <input> type="checkbox" name="name" value="value" checked="checked" name相同为一组 value区分值 多选
下拉列表 <select> type="checkbox" name="name" size="4" 下面加<option value="值">名</option> 一组选择框
文本域 <textarea> rows="1" cols="10" onpropertychange="this.style.posHeight=this.scrollHeight"
按钮 <button> type="button submit reset" name="name" 按钮 submit 提交当前表 reset 重置表单
框架 <iframe> <iframe name = "" src="" width="" allowtransparency="true" scrolling="no" frameborder="0" /> 插入框架
背景颜色 Bgcolor <body bgcolor="#666" />
背景图片 BgcGround <body Background="bg.gif" />

常用技巧

禁止选取 复制 <body onselectstart="return false">
10秒后跳转 <meta http-equiv="Refresh" content="10;URL=http://www.baidu.com" />
ico图标 <link rel="Shortcut Icon" href="favicon.ico" >
背景音乐 <bgsound src="音乐url" loop="-1">
首页
<a href="#"
onclick=this.style.behavior=‘url(#default#homepage)‘;
this.setHomePage(‘http://链接‘); >设为首页</a>
收藏夹 <a href="Javascript :window.external.addFavorite(‘http://链接‘,‘说明‘);" > 加入收藏夹</a>
时间: 2024-08-09 19:15:17

18、HTML的相关文章

18、Cocos2dx 3.0游戏开发找小三之cocos2d-x,请问你是怎么调度的咩

重开发者的劳动成果,转载的时候请务必注明出处:http://blog.csdn.net/haomengzhu/article/details/30478251 Cocos2d 的一大特色就是提供了事件驱动的游戏框架, 引擎会在合适的时候调用事件处理函数,我们只需要在函数中添加对各种游戏事件的处理, 就可以完成一个完整的游戏了. 例如,为了实现游戏的动态变化,Cocos2d 提供了两种定时器事件: 为了响应用户输入,Cocos2d 提供了触摸事件和传感器事件: 此外,Cocos2d 还提供了一系列

18、蛤蟆的数据结构笔记之十八链表实现稀疏矩阵

18.蛤蟆的数据结构笔记之十八链表实现稀疏矩阵 本篇名言:"必须如蜜蜂一样,采过许多花,才能酿出蜜来." 上篇中实现了栈在多项式实现中的例子,再来看下稀疏矩阵通过链表方式实现. 关键字:十字链表存储 欢迎转载,转载请标明出处: 1.  十字链表存储 十字链表(OrthogonalList)是有向图的另一种链式存储结构.该结构可以看成是将有向图的邻接表和逆邻接表结合起来得到的.用十字链表来存储有向图,可以达到高效的存取效果.同时,代码的可读性也会得到提升. 为便于理解后续代码,从网上摘了

18、GPS技术

GPS核心API Android SDK为GPS提供了很多API,其中LocationManager类是这些API的核心.LocationManager是一个系统服务类,与TelephonyManager.AudioManager等服务类的作用和创建服务类对象的方法类似.所有与GPS相关的操作都由LocationManager对象及其派生的对象完成. LocationManager lm = (LocationManager) getSystemService(Context.LOCATION_

17、如何对字符串进行左, 右, 居中对齐 18、如何去掉字符串中不需要的字符 19、如何读写文本文件 20、如何处理二进制文件 21、如何设置文件的缓冲

17.如何对字符串进行左, 右, 居中对齐 info = "GBK" print(info.ljust(20)) print(info.ljust(20,'#')) print(info.rjust(20,'#')) print(info.center(20,"#")) print(format(info,'<20')) print(format(info,'>20')) print(format(info,'^20')) result: GBK GBK

【ThinkingInC++】18、指向函数的指针数组

/** * 功能:指向函数的指针数组 * 时间:2014年8月14日07:24:46 * 作者:cutter_point */ #include<iostream> #include<cstdlib> using namespace std; //这里N就是函数名,而DF(N)就代表了后面的N函数,N可以变 #define DF(N) void N() {cout<<"function "#N" is called"<<

ABP(现代ASP.NET样板开发框架)系列之18、ABP应用层——权限验证

点这里进入ABP系列文章总目录 ABP(现代ASP.NET样板开发框架)系列之18.ABP应用层——权限验证 ABP是“ASP.NET Boilerplate Project (ASP.NET样板项目)”的简称. ABP的官方网站:http://www.aspnetboilerplate.com ABP在Github上的开源项目:https://github.com/aspnetboilerplate 几乎所有的企业级应用程序都会有不同级别的权限验证.权限验证是用于检查用户是否允许某些指定操作.

换工作?请记得8、18、48与72这四个密码

换工作写简历时,最常碰到要填写的数字,当然是你过去的工作经历与工作多久的年限,小心,时间的长短,其实是 HR 决定录不录用你的关键因素,怎么说呢? 根据<Fortune>杂志报导,8.18.48 与 72 这四个数字,就是找工作的四大地雷数字,不可不慎. 以 8 来说,如果你上一个工作只待了 8 个月,建议你在填简历表时,还不如不要写上去比较好. 为什么呢?因为这代表你可能没有通过该公司的试用期或是每半年一次的绩效审核,所以被踢出来了,因此,看起来多写一项工作经历好像可以为简历表加分,实则如果

18、红外

一.红外线工作原理 1.红外线系统的组成 红外线遥控器已被广泛使用在各种类型的家电产品上,它的出现给使用电器提供了很多的便利.红外线系统一般由红外发射装置和红外接收设备两大部分组成.红外发射装置又可由键盘电路.红外编码芯片.电源和红外发射电路组成.红外接收设备可由红外接收电路.红外解码芯片.电源和应用电路组成.通常为了使信号更好的被发射端发送出去,经常会将二进制数据信号调制成为脉冲信号,通过红外发射管发射.常用的有通过脉冲宽度来实现信号调制的脉宽调制(PWM)和通过脉冲串之间的时间间隔来实现信号

18、ESC/POS指令集在android设备上使用实例(通过socket)

网上关于通过android来操作打印机的例子太少了,为了方便更多的开发同仁,将近日所学分享一下. 我这边是通过android设备通过无线来对打印机(佳博58mm热敏式-58130iC)操作,实现餐厅小票的打印.写了一个简单的小demo,分享下. 前提: 1.android设备一个(coolPad8085N) 2.小票打印机(佳博 58mm热敏式打印机-58130IC) 这里将打印机IP设置为固定IP(这里略微复杂,是前辈设置过的,我没有具体操作,问了一下:打印机自检出的条子可以显示IP.通过自带

2017年1月18、19日活动记录

日程: 2017.1.18 1.运用多种方法制作水仙花数: (1)运用一重循环法制作水仙花数(do while) (2)运用三重循环法制作水仙花数(do while) (3)运用直到循环法制作水仙花数 2.直到循环1到100的和: (1)亿图软件制作流程图(2)利用VB制作直到循环1到100的和 3.十进制.二进制.十六进制之间的相互转化及其意义,列出了十进制.二进制.十六进制之间基数的转换表 4.利用亿图软件制作十进制转二进制流程图 5.利用辅助软件熟悉VB语句,并尝试了beep语句 6.利用